Having S-AFC problems need your help
I was starting to run lean in 3rd gear and up so I put in my S-AFC and now it runs even leaner and the bitch of it is ever time I shut off the car the S-AFC loses all the settings and I have to sit there and set it up all over again. I hooked it up like it said in the vehicle specfic book so what's up is the guide wrong?(power wire is black with white strip right?) Here are the settings I am using Flap 6in 6out, 4cylinder arrow up, low setting 60% high 80%, I start at 8000rpm @+10% and go down 1% ever 1000 same thing for low but start at 7%. Now here is what is up with my fuel problem when I am getting in to it second gear and up at 4000rpm or so it goes off the scale lean but if I back out of it and get back in it it goes back up to mid stocih on the autometer. Also I will get a wiff of gas and no it isn't the pulse damper already checked that. I have some 720cc secondaries for it but I lack the know how to put them in. (throttle body looks like a bitch). fuel system!!!
If you have an 91 turbo, you have the better wastegate, I only see 10-11 psi on a very cold night. I have my afc only tuned down before the secondaries come in. I do not have it turned up after 4,500 rpms. and I still read rich @11 psi on a cold night under full throttle with the stock fuel system.
There is something wrong with your fuel system. If you have to turn your afc up 10%, 9 % 8% of something like that, there is something wrong. Your going to fry your injectors running 7-10% more fuel.
I would try and get those 720 cc and check the voltage to your fuel pump. Probably get it prof. tuned.

Do a search with my user name.... and S-AFC as the topic.
I have a few wiring fixes that totally solved my problems.... my car would barely run.... and I had to lean it out 40-50% to get it to run OK... then when it warmed up it would need -20% to run.... it was messed... the RPM was a few hunded off too.
It's all fixed now.
I found that I lost settings one time- but that was all... I -THINK- that you may have to exit the settings menu- and go back to the main menu for the new settings to stay in once you turn the car off....
